Retained earnings of Armenia-based banks in 2012 grew by 14.66 percent to 42.4 billion drams

YEREVAN, January 18. / ARKA /. Retained earnings of 21 Armenia-based banks in 2012 grew by 14.66 percent from the previous year to 42.4 billion drams, according to ARKA news agency’s Banks of Armenia bulletin.

Eighteen of 21 banks posted 45.5 billion drams in total income, while three other banks posted 3 billion drams in losses. Below are the five leading banks by size of income last year. -0-
